(Learning Objective 3: Determine depreciation amounts by three methods) LimaPizza bought a used Toyota delivery van on January 2, 2018, for $18,600. The van wasexpected to remain in service for four years (57,000 miles). At the end of its useful life, Limamanagement estimated that the van’s residual value would be $1,500. The van traveled 20,500miles the first year, 16,000 miles the second year, 15,400 miles the third year, and 5,100 milesin the fourth year.Requirements1. Prepare a schedule of depreciation expense per year for the van under the three depreciationmethods discussed in this chapter. (For units-of-production and double-declining-balancemethods, round to the nearest two decimal places after each step of the calculation.)2. Which method best tracks the wear and tear on the van?3. Which method would Lima prefer to use for income tax purposes? Explain your reasoningin detail.
